Features
/square4 Low insertion loss: /square4 0.38dB at 2.4GHz /square4 0.45dB at 6GHz /square4 High Isolation: /square4 39dB at 2.4GHz /square4 High Linearity: /square4 IIP2 +125dBm at 2.4GHz /square4 IIP3 +77dBm at 2.4GHz /square4 P0.1dB compression of +40dBm at 2.4GHz /square4 Second Harmonic: z95dBc at 900MHz /square4 Third Harmonic: z90dBc at 900MHz /square4 Supply voltage: +2.7V to +5.25V /square4 1.8V and 3.3V compatible control logic /square4 z40°C to +105°C operating temperature range /square4 2mm x 2mm, 12zpin VFQFPzN package Block Diagram Figure 1. Application Information
A common V CC power supply should be used for all pins requiring DC pow er. All supply pins should be bypassed with external capac itors to minimize noise and fast transients. Supply noise can degrade noise figure and fast transients can trigger ESD clamps and cause them to fail. Supply voltage change or transients should have a slew rate smaller than 1V / 20µs. In addition, all control pins should remain at 0V (+/z 0.3V) while the supply voltage ramps up or while it returns to zero.
